Type II Error
Occurs when a statistical test fails to reject a false null hypothesis; also known as a false negative.
Level Of Significance
A threshold in hypothesis testing that determines whether or not the null hypothesis can be rejected.
Null Hypothesis
A default premise stating no statistical significance or effect, used as a starting point for hypothesis testing to be either rejected or not rejected.
